ClubEnsayos.com - Ensayos de Calidad, Tareas y Monografias
Buscar

Condicionales


Enviado por   •  25 de Septiembre de 2014  •  925 Palabras (4 Páginas)  •  346 Visitas

Página 1 de 4

¿Qué es un condicional?

Un condicional en la programación es una sentencia o grupo de sentencias que puede ejecutarse o no en función del valor de una condición.

Los tipos más conocidos de condicionales son el SI ENTONCES (if then), el SI - SI NO (if then- else) y el SEGÚN (case o switch), aunque también podríamos mencionar al lanzamiento de errores como una alternativa más moderna para evitar el "anidamiento" de condicionales.

Los condicionales constituyen junto con los bucles los pilares de la programación estructurada, y su uso es una evolución de una sentencia de lenguaje ensamblador que ejecutaba la siguiente línea o no en función del valor de una condición.

Condicional simple

Condicional simple.

Cuando se presenta la elección tenemos la opción de realizar una actividad o no realizar ninguna.

Representación gráfica:

Podemos observar: El rombo representa la condición. Hay dos opciones que se pueden tomar. Si la condición da verdadera se sigue el camino del verdadero, o sea el de la derecha, si la condición da falsa se sigue el camino de la izquierda.

Se trata de una estructura CONDICIONAL SIMPLE porque por el camino del verdadero hay actividades y por el camino del falso no hay actividades.

Por el camino del verdadero pueden existir varias operaciones, entradas y salidas, inclusive ya veremos que puede haber otras estructuras condicionales.

Biodiccional

En matemáticas y lógica, un bicondicional, (también llamado equivalencia o doble implicación, en ocasiones abreviado como ssi, sii, o syss), es una proposición de la forma "P si y solo si Q" y afirma que la proposición P será verdadera cuando y exclusivamente Q también lo sea, así como también P será falsa cuando Q lo sea. Otra forma de expresar el bicondicional es decir que Q es una condición necesaria y suficiente para P.

El valor de verdad de un bicondicional «p si y solo si q» es verdadero cuando ambas proposiciones (p y q) tienen el mismo valor de verdad, es decir, ambas son verdaderas o falsas simultáneamente; de lo contrario, es falso.

Se tiene así que la afirmación «p si y solo si q» es lógicamente equivalente al par de afirmaciones «Si p, entonces q», y «si q, entonces p». Escrito con símbolos lógicos:

.

De manera más precisa, el operador bicondicional está definido mediante la siguiente tabla de verdad:

si y sólo si

p q p ↔ q

V V V

V F F

F V F

F F V

Representación y lectura

Normalmente se usan los símbolo ⇔ o ↔ para denotar el bicondicional, quedando así:

o .

En español se usan las abreviaturas sii, ssi y syss, de modo que es equivalente p ↔ q a “p sii q”. En inglés se abrevia iff (If and only if).

Dos enunciados se dicen equivalentes cuando tienen el mismo valor de verdad, y se simboliza con ≡.3 Este símbolo también puede leerse "es equivalente a". Cuando dos proposiciones son lógicamente equivalentes su conexión con un bicondicional una tautología. Adicionalmente, el bicondicional es equivalente a la puerta lógica XNOR, y

...

Descargar como (para miembros actualizados)  txt (5.8 Kb)  
Leer 3 páginas más »
Disponible sólo en Clubensayos.com